Galatians 1:11-19 (Epistle, Saint)
- 11
 - But I make known to you, brethren, that the gospel which was preached by me is not according to man.
 - 12
 - For I neither received it from man, nor was I taught it, but it came through the revelation of Jesus Christ.
 - 13
 - For you have heard of my former conduct in Judaism, how I persecuted the church of God beyond measure and tried to destroy it.
 - 14
 - And I advanced in Judaism beyond many of my contemporaries in my own nation, being more exceedingly zealous for the traditions of my fathers.
 - 15
 - But when it pleased God, who separated me from my mother’s womb and called me through His grace,
 - 16
 - to reveal His Son in me, that I might preach Him among the Gentiles, I did not immediately confer with flesh and blood,
 - 17
 - nor did I go up to Jerusalem to those who were apostles before me; but I went to Arabia, and returned again to Damascus.
 - 18
 - Then after three years I went up to Jerusalem to see Peter, and remained with him fifteen days.
 - 19
 - But I saw none of the other apostles except James, the Lord’s brother.
